Abstract: | For single pulse operation it was demonstrated that a low-pressure mercury lamp can successfully pump the atomic iodine laser using the active medium CF3I. For a 22 ms long pump pulse an output energy of 100 mJ emitted over the same time duration was obtained. Measured oscillator efficiency was 0.54%. With respect to stored optical energy an efficiency of 1.6% was realized, a value not obtained so far with any other pump source. Application to pulsed high repetition rate or cw-operation seems possible at equal or even better efficiency. |
